From the Library
Grand Opening
With the final delivery of shelving scheduled for week 1 of term, our library redevelopment is almost complete. Woohoo! Our Rascals tamariki have already tested out the space over the break and one year 4 student called it, "the best library I've ever been to!"
At 2pm on Thursday 12th February, we'll be welcoming Alan Dingley, (NZ's Te Awhi Rito Reading Ambassador 2023–2025) as a guest speaker at our Library Grand Opening. Alan is travelling down from Palmerston North to share his passion for reading and to help officially open the space. Whānau are warmly welcomed to attend this hui if they are interested.
Borrowing
Students will begin borrowing books in their regular weekly class library slot as of week 3. We are encouraging students of all year levels to use a book bag to transport library books in order to protect them. If your child has a book bag, please help ensure it's in the backpack on their library day. The library has spares that can be used and returned to school. The library will also be open for browsing and borrowing during lunchtimes once our student librarian team is up and running.

Regular Attendance Matters
School attendance is legally required in New Zealand. Your child should be at school every day the school is open unless they are unwell or have an agreed, justifiable reason. Schools record daily attendance and work with whānau when attendance becomes a concern. Attending more than 90 % of the term is considered regular attendance by the Ministry of Education. In 2025 we had 71% regular attendance and we have a target of lifting our regular attendance to 75% by the end of 2026. It’s those pesky term time ski trips dragging us down 🤭!
